Transaction 603448763455e3d33cfd8ad8187b93405c2f441031ac2a1c2c85f9962cd39a2e
1 Input
1 Output
-
603448763455e3d33cfd8ad8187b93405c2f441031ac2a1c2c85f9962cd39a2e:0
- value
- 170000
- script pubkey
- OP_0 OP_PUSHBYTES_20 3a23eb007c35c3e3d7f632ac72604569f85608a1
- address
- bc1q8g37kqruxhp784lkx2k8ycz9d8u9vz9p7kcaaz